Yandex has launched food delivery using courier robots on the main campus of Ohio State University in the United States. This was reported on the website of the company Grubhub, in partnership with which the delivery is carried out.
Deliver orders within the campus, where more than 60,000 students live and study, will be delivered by 50 fully automatic courier robots. They will work daily from 9 am to 9 pm.
Robots will be able to deliver orders from local cafes to the doors of educational buildings, dormitories or libraries.
Tigran Khudaverdyan, managing director of the Yandex group of companies, on his Facebook called it “the first commercial project in the history of unmanned technologies.”
